About Christopher 

A former Marine officer, combat veteran, and black man with nearly 30 years of experience in leadership development, Christopher supports leaders to embrace the vulnerability, courage, and compassion required in elevating their leadership influence and creating leaders with greater impact and results. 

Christopher has experience working with leaders in the public, private, and non-profit sectors, ranging from front-line supervisors with an emphasis on senior and C-suite executives. 

Christopher has a Master’s of Organizational Leadership and a Master’s in Business Administration. He completed his coach training through the Co-Active Training Institute, the oldest and largest in-person coach training program in the world. He is a Certified Professional Co-Active Coach (CPCC) and holds a Professional Certified Coach (PCC) credential through the International Coach Federation (ICF.) Christopher is certified in The Leadership Circle Profile 360, and the Myers-Briggs Type Indicator (MBTI).

What makes a coaching relationship great?

Trust – In order for my clients be able to commit to the coaching process, they must know and understand that I’m committed to their growth and transformation. I also must trust that they will commit to being engaged in the coaching conversations.

Showing up – I am a resource and an ally for my clients in their journeys; however, nothing will get accomplished if they don’t show up and do the work required. We all have days where we’re not feeling on our “A” game. I expect that you show up and give your best effort, even if your best that day may not be what it was the day before.

Embrace imperfection – Let’s face it, we’re all human. We make mistakes. I never encourage or expect my clients to pursue perfection; that is just fuel for our Saboteurs to run amok. I do, however, encourage my clients to grow and improve, to strive to become better versions of themselves based upon the goals they’ve created. I don’t expect you to be flawless (I know I’m certainly not.) I do expect you to learn from experiences and then use that knowledge in moving forward.

What characteristics do I admire?

Sense of humor – I’ve found that having a sense of humor can help get me through some challenging times. It also helps keep me humble by being able to laugh at myself and not take myself too seriously all the time. 

Authenticity – I like to be around people that are comfortable in who they are and don’t waste time worrying about being someone they are not. Being true to yourself is one of the most ultimate expressions of authenticity. 

Being open – Open to new ideas, to new experiences, to new perspectives. If someone can’t be open to the possibility of different ways of seeing the world and other people, we’re probably not going to be a good match.
